
Students will learn to analyse issues through different perspectives, considering how a variety of different sociologists would consider the same problem. This will also help develop discussion skills as students learn to take on board differing opinions. They will also learn to evaluate the usefulness of theories and studies, considering the quality of the research carried out and its relevance to modern society.
For success in Sociology, students should have achieved a Grade 6 in GCSE English Literature or GCSE English Language. Sociology will appeal to students who enjoy debating social issues and who are keen to explore their ideas about societal inequalities.
